Roof and chimney repair involves addressing issues where the chimney meets the roofline. This often means repairing or replacing damaged flashing, which is the material that seals the gap between the chimney and the roof to prevent water leaks. It can also include repairing any damage to the shingles or underlying roof structure caused by water infiltration around the chimney. Ensuring this seal is intact is crucial for preventing leaks.

Chimney flue repair in Fargo often involves addressing cracks or damage to the liner inside the chimney. This liner is essential for protecting the chimney structure from heat and corrosive byproducts of combustion. Repairs might include relining the flue with a new material, such as stainless steel or cast-in-place cement. If the damper is damaged, that would also be part of flue system repair. Proper flue function is critical for safety.

Chimney sweep and repair services combine cleaning with necessary fixes. A chimney sweep cleans out creosote and soot buildup, which is a major fire hazard. During this process, the sweep can identify any damage to the chimney's structure, such as cracked liners or deteriorating mortar. If repairs are needed, they can often be addressed at the same time. This offers a convenient, comprehensive approach to chimney maintenance and safety.
Chimney repair can be made more affordable by addressing issues promptly. Small problems, like a minor crack in the mortar or a loose brick, are less expensive to fix than extensive damage that has worsened over time. Regular inspections can help catch these minor issues early. Also, getting multiple free quotes can help you compare services and pricing. Proactive maintenance is key to managing costs effectively.
